14-Year Old from San Antonio Wins National Spelling Bee

14-Year Old from San Antonio Wins National Spelling Bee

Washington (WBAP/KLIF) – A 14-year old from San Antonio won the National Scripps Spelling Bee. Harini Logan, defeated Vikram Raju in the bee’s first-ever lightning-round tie-breaker. Both spellers got four words wrong during their grueling showdown before Scripps went to the 90-second spell-off. Harini was faster and sharper throughout, spelling 21 words correctly to beat…MORE
